Today In Spurs History: 5th May

1962 – On this day in 1962, Spurs took on Burnley in the FA Cup final. Jimmy Greaves gave us the lead and though Burnley equalised in the second half, we stormed back to win 3-1, with goals from Bobby Smith and Danny Blanchflower.

1994 – A relegation-threatened Tottenham side won 2-0 at Oldham’s Boundary Park, with goals from David Howells and Vinny Samways. No matter what the result tonight, we should keep in mind that it wasn’t so long ago that this was our idea of a crucial match.
